Output e5c6a96f7bdb311f2fcfacbf6b7e30a2184140105a909e235bbb51c99cf2d19d:121

value
179295
script pubkey
OP_0 OP_PUSHBYTES_20 2eb1167d6e7fdb2e9fdaf53ca50ee5c1421981b3
address
bc1q96c3vltw0ldja87675722rh9c9ppnqdnmvnfdr
transaction
e5c6a96f7bdb311f2fcfacbf6b7e30a2184140105a909e235bbb51c99cf2d19d
confirmations
43778
spent
true